質問するログイン新規登録

質問編集履歴

3

追記

2016/06/26 06:49

投稿

earnest_gay
earnest_gay

スコア615

title CHANGED
File without changes
body CHANGED
@@ -69,4 +69,10 @@
69
69
  `skill` varchar(255) DEFAULT NULL,
70
70
  `year` varchar(255) DEFAULT NULL,
71
71
  PRIMARY KEY (`id`)
72
- ) ENGINE=InnoDB AUTO_INCREMENT=103 DEFAULT CHARSET=utf8 |
72
+ ) ENGINE=InnoDB AUTO_INCREMENT=103 DEFAULT CHARSET=utf8 |
73
+
74
+
75
+
76
+
77
+ 読み込めないというより、取得できていないのです...
78
+ ![イメージ説明](5b2e44d7bdd3a1ce4da7f620bcb9ac77.png)

2

追記

2016/06/26 06:48

投稿

earnest_gay
earnest_gay

スコア615

title CHANGED
File without changes
body CHANGED
@@ -17,4 +17,56 @@
17
17
 
18
18
 
19
19
  どうしたら良いのでしょうか?
20
- とりあえず動作確認したいので、コマンドプロントで確認しています。
20
+ とりあえず動作確認したいので、コマンドプロントで確認しています。
21
+
22
+ テーブル構造は下記の通りです。
23
+
24
+ user_data | CREATE TABLE `user_data` (
25
+ `id` int(11) NOT NULL AUTO_INCREMENT,
26
+ `created`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,
27
+ `email` varchar(50) NOT NULL,
28
+ `password` varchar(255) NOT NULL,
29
+ `name1` varchar(255) DEFAULT NULL,
30
+ `name2` varchar(255) DEFAULT NULL,
31
+ `name3` varchar(255) DEFAULT NULL,
32
+ `name4` varchar(255) DEFAULT NULL,
33
+ `name5` varchar(255) DEFAULT NULL,
34
+ `name6` varchar(255) DEFAULT NULL,
35
+ `middle_name` varchar(255) DEFAULT NULL,
36
+ `birth_year` varchar(255) NOT NULL,
37
+ `birth_month` varchar(255) NOT NULL,
38
+ `birth_day` varchar(255) NOT NULL,
39
+ `gender` char(2) NOT NULL,
40
+ `first_post` varchar(255) NOT NULL,
41
+ `last_post` varchar(255) NOT NULL,
42
+ `pref` varchar(255) NOT NULL,
43
+ `city` varchar(255) NOT NULL,
44
+ `town` varchar(255) NOT NULL,
45
+ `building` varchar(255) DEFAULT NULL,
46
+ `tel1` varchar(255) NOT NULL,
47
+ `tel2` varchar(255) NOT NULL,
48
+ `tel3` varchar(255) NOT NULL,
49
+ PRIMARY KEY (`id`),
50
+ UNIQUE KEY `email` (`email`)
51
+ ) ENGINE=InnoDB AUTO_INCREMENT=63 DEFAULT CHARSET=utf8 |
52
+
53
+
54
+
55
+ user_pr | CREATE TABLE `user_pr` (
56
+ `id` int(11) NOT NULL AUTO_INCREMENT,
57
+ `user_id` int(11) NOT NULL,
58
+ `major_category` varchar(255) NOT NULL,
59
+ `major_skill` varchar(255) NOT NULL,
60
+ `cont_date` varchar(255) NOT NULL,
61
+ `introduction` text NOT NULL,
62
+ PRIMARY KEY (`id`)
63
+ ) ENGINE=InnoDB AUTO_INCREMENT=25 DEFAULT CHARSET=utf8 |
64
+
65
+
66
+ user_skill | CREATE TABLE `user_skill` (
67
+ `id` int(11) NOT NULL AUTO_INCREMENT,
68
+ `user_id` int(11) NOT NULL,
69
+ `skill` varchar(255) DEFAULT NULL,
70
+ `year` varchar(255) DEFAULT NULL,
71
+ PRIMARY KEY (`id`)
72
+ ) ENGINE=InnoDB AUTO_INCREMENT=103 DEFAULT CHARSET=utf8 |

1

追記

2016/06/26 06:41

投稿

earnest_gay
earnest_gay

スコア615

title CHANGED
File without changes
body CHANGED
@@ -10,7 +10,7 @@
10
10
  上記で一覧が取得できていますが、更にもうひとつuser_skillというテーブルを参照(計3テーブル)することになり
11
11
 
12
12
  ```sql
13
- SELECT user_data.id,user_pr.user_id,user_skill.user_id FROM user_data,user_pr.user_skill WHERE user_data.id=user_pr.user_id=user_skill.user_id;
13
+ SELECT user_data.id,user_pr.user_id,user_skill.user_id FROM user_data,user_pr,user_skill WHERE user_data.id=user_pr.user_id=user_skill.user_id;
14
14
  ```
15
15
 
16
16
  という風にしているのですが、読み込めずです...